Output 1625e2c28393324e01f0eb3aa6e4c18c2862f803373fab3a9cdd13d7ad60ce1b:5

value
109371419
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d1a845719926e1f66f06f7252345b708ba01f67 OP_EQUAL
address
3JvuQEHsWRkZVjFDJmVBNKbfHN3jaCxg8v
transaction
1625e2c28393324e01f0eb3aa6e4c18c2862f803373fab3a9cdd13d7ad60ce1b
spent
true